An Emotional and Personal Wedding Ceremony

The ceremony took place in the Sereno Sand area of the hotel, which is a sand-covered deck that overlooks the ocean without being exactly on the beach. It’s conveniently located right beside the ramp to the beach in case the couple wants to take photos on the beach after the wedding (which we did).
